In the long run Google probably does not care that much. They’ve been busy moving the tracking into the browser itself with the Protected Audience API.<p>Technically they don’t track you personally and nobody has a database of your preferences. The browser does and just runs auctions to serve you ads.<p>This kind of tech renders the DMA, GDPR and cookie banners moot, while keeping the money printing machine that is Google Ad business running.
